Background
The rotary drilling machine is a comprehensive drilling machine, can be used for various bottom layers, and has the characteristics of high hole forming speed, less pollution, strong maneuverability and the like. Short auger bits perform dry excavation operations, and rotary drill bits may also be used to perform wet excavation operations with mud dado. The rotary excavator can be matched with a hammer to drill and dig holes in hard stratum. If the reamer is matched with a reaming head drilling tool, reaming operation can be carried out at the bottom of the hole. The rotary excavating machine adopts a plurality of layers of telescopic drill rods, has less drilling auxiliary time and low labor intensity, does not need slurry to discharge slag circularly, saves cost and is particularly suitable for the basic construction of urban construction.
When clearing up the flat end of the clear drill bit of the machine of digging soon among the prior art, can deposit the rubble that gets off and earth in the casing of drill bit, when clearing up the inside earth of casing, need strike the casing and make inside earth shake out, lead to the junction emergence fracture of pivot and casing easily when striking to the drill bit of lower extreme is not convenient for change for wearing and tearing the piece when clearing up the bottom surface. Accordingly, there is a need for improvements in the art.

Examples
Referring to fig. 1-4, a flat bottom cleaning drill bit of a rotary drilling rig comprises a shell 1, a sliding sleeve 2 is fixedly sleeved inside the upper end of the shell 1, a telescopic rod 3 is slidably connected inside the sliding sleeve 2, a push plate 4 is fixedly connected to the lower end of the telescopic rod 3, a storage tank 5 is arranged inside the shell 1, the inner wall of the storage tank 5 is slidably connected with the outer side of the push plate 4, a spring 6 is slidably sleeved outside the telescopic rod 3, the lower end of the shell 1 is connected with an installation shell 7 through a bolt, a drill bit 9 is slidably connected inside the lower end of the installation shell 7, a screw 10 is slidably connected inside the installation shell 7, the outer side of the screw 10 is connected with the inner side of the drill bit 9 through a thread, a limit sleeve 11 is fixedly connected inside the installation shell 7, a limit rod 12 is fixedly connected to the lower end of the shell 1, and the outer side of the limit rod 12 is in contact connection with the inner side of the limit sleeve 11, a support column 14 is fixedly connected to the upper end of the housing 1.
Referring to fig. 3, a second screw 8 is slidably connected to the inside of the mounting housing 7, the outer side of the second screw 8 is connected to the inside of the housing 1 through a screw thread, and the second screw 8 is used for connecting and fixing the mounting housing 7.
Referring to fig. 4, the upper end of the spring 6 is fixedly connected with the upper end of the telescopic rod 3, the lower end of the spring 6 is fixedly connected with the upper end of the sliding sleeve 2, and the spring 6 can keep the push plate 4 at the highest position in the storage tank 5 all the time, so as to avoid affecting the internal sludge storage amount.
Referring to fig. 1, a reinforcing rib 17 is welded to the outer side of the supporting column 14, the lower end of the reinforcing rib 17 is welded to the upper end of the housing 1, and the reinforcing rib 17 can increase the connection strength between the supporting column 14 and the housing 1.
Referring to fig. 1, a connecting plate 15 is fixedly connected to an upper end of the supporting column 14, a rotating shaft 16 is fixedly connected to an upper end of the connecting plate 15, and the rotating shaft 16 can drive the casing 1 and the drill bit 9 to rotate.
Referring to fig. 3, the number of the limiting rods 12 is multiple, the limiting rods 12 are uniformly distributed at the lower end of the housing 1, and the shearing force applied to the second screw 8 can be reduced when the limiting rods 12 rotate.
